    /**
     * Explicitly exposes an LDAP compare operation which JNDI does not
     * directly provide.  All normalization and schema checking etcetera
     * is handled by this call.
     *
     * @param name the name of the entri
     * @param oid the name or object identifier for the attribute to compare
     * @param value the value to compare the attribute to
     * @return true if the entry has the value for the attribute, false otherwise
     * @throws NamingException if the backing store cannot be accessed, or
     * permission is not allowed for this operation or the oid is not recognized,
     * or the attribute is not present in the entry ... you get the picture.
     */
    public boolean compare( Dn name, String oid, Object value ) throws NamingException
    {
        Value<?> val = null;

        AttributeType attributeType = null;

        try
        {
            attributeType = getService().getSchemaManager().lookupAttributeTypeRegistry( oid );
        }
        catch ( LdapException le )
        {
            throw new InvalidAttributeIdentifierException( le.getMessage() );
        }

        // make sure we add the request controls to operation
        try
        {
            if ( attributeType.getSyntax().isHumanReadable() )
            {
                if ( value instanceof String )
                {
                    val = new StringValue( attributeType, ( String ) value );
                }
                else if ( value instanceof byte[] )
                {
                    val = new StringValue( attributeType, Strings.utf8ToString( ( byte[] ) value ) );
                }
                else
                {
                    throw new NamingException( I18n.err( I18n.ERR_309, oid ) );
                }
            }
            else
            {
                if ( value instanceof String )
                {
                    val = new BinaryValue( attributeType, Strings.getBytesUtf8( ( String ) value ) );
                }
                else if ( value instanceof byte[] )
                {
                    val = new BinaryValue( attributeType, ( byte[] ) value );
                }
                else
                {
                    throw new NamingException( I18n.err( I18n.ERR_309, oid ) );
                }
            }
        }
        catch ( LdapInvalidAttributeValueException liave )
        {
            throw new NamingException( I18n.err( I18n.ERR_309, oid ) );
        }

        CompareOperationContext opCtx = new CompareOperationContext( getSession(), name, oid, val );

        try
        {
            opCtx.addRequestControls( JndiUtils.fromJndiControls( getDirectoryService().getLdapCodecService(),
                requestControls ) );
        }
        catch ( DecoderException e1 )
        {
            throw new NamingException( I18n.err( I18n.ERR_309, oid ) );
        }

        // Inject the Referral flag
        injectReferralControl( opCtx );

        // execute operation
        boolean result = false;
        try
        {
            result = super.getDirectoryService().getOperationManager().compare( opCtx );
        }
        catch ( Exception e )
        {
            JndiUtils.wrap( e );
        }

        // extract the response controls from the operation and return
        responseControls = getResponseControls();
        requestControls = EMPTY_CONTROLS;
        return result;
    }


    /**
     * Calling this method tunnels an unbind call down into the partition holding
     * the bindDn.  The bind() counter part is not exposed because it is automatically
     * called when you create a new initial context for a new connection (on wire) or
     * (programatic) caller.
     *
     * @throws NamingException if there are failures encountered while unbinding
     */
    public void ldapUnbind() throws NamingException
    {
        UnbindOperationContext opCtx = new UnbindOperationContext( getSession() );

        try
        {
            opCtx.addRequestControls( JndiUtils.fromJndiControls( getDirectoryService().getLdapCodecService(),
                requestControls ) );
        }
        catch ( DecoderException e1 )
        {
            throw new NamingException( I18n.err( I18n.ERR_309, "unbind encoder exception" ) );
        }

        try
        {
            super.getDirectoryService().getOperationManager().unbind( opCtx );
        }
        catch ( Exception e )
        {
            JndiUtils.wrap( e );
        }

        try
        {
            responseControls = JndiUtils.toJndiControls( getDirectoryService().getLdapCodecService(),
                opCtx.getResponseControls() );
        }
        catch ( EncoderException e )
        {
            throw new NamingException( I18n.err( I18n.ERR_309, "unbind encoder exception" ) );
        }
        requestControls = EMPTY_CONTROLS;
    }
